Exploring Social Casinos: Gameplay for Fun and Practice
Social casinos are digital platforms designed primarily for free play. These sites let you enjoy popular slots, table games, and more with virtual coins or credits, emphasizing fun and social interaction rather than financial rewards. While gameplay resembles what you’ll find in real money casinos, no actual cash is at stake.

Social casinos offer risk-free gaming and social interaction.
- No financial risk—you never lose real money.
- A sociable platform to connect and play with friends online.
- Ideal for practicing strategies before transitioning to real money gaming.
However, the major drawback is that all winnings are virtual; you cannot cash out or turn your success into actual profit.
Leading names in the social casino space include Zynga, Slotomania, and Big Fish Casino, each boasting large, active user communities. These sites are legal and unrestricted because no money can be lost, and they operate with in-game currencies instead of cash. Players can usually purchase additional credits or coins to continue playing, which is where social casinos generate revenue.
While the gameplay is risk-free, some debate remains over whether free casino games can encourage compulsive play. Still, the overwhelming majority use these platforms purely for entertainment without any of the pressure associated with gambling for real money.
The most commonly played games at social casinos are slot machines, but options often include blackjack, roulette, and even social poker rooms. The virtual currency system introduces an element of progression and achievement even in the absence of cash winnings.
Online Casinos: The Real Money Gaming Experience
Online casinos represent the more traditional side of internet gaming, giving players the opportunity to bet—and win or lose—actual money. These platforms offer a full suite of casino games with a realistic chance of financial gain, but also expose players to the risk of losses.
- Potential to win real cash payouts.
- Highly engaging and thrilling gameplay.
- A wide selection of licensed casinos and hundreds (sometimes thousands) of game titles.
But, this comes with the potential downside of losing money during play.
With far more online casinos than social platforms, players benefit from greater choice—but also face challenges in identifying safe, legitimate operators. Most reputable sites undergo strict licensing and regulatory checks; always confirm a casino’s credentials, look for SSL security, and check for independent audits before signing up.
A key advantage is the game selection. Online casinos provide access to a vast array of slots, classic table games, video poker, scratchcards, and increasingly, live dealer rooms where gameplay is streamed in real-time with professional croupiers. Many allow you to try slots and table games in demo mode using practice credits, which is a great way to learn without financial risk.
It’s worth noting that, for most games, playing at an online casino is a solitary experience. If community and chat features are important, consider real money poker rooms or bingo sites, both of which support social engagement alongside gambling.
Key Differences Between Social and Online Casinos
To clarify the contrasts between these platforms, here’s a simple overview:
Feature | Social Casinos | Online Casinos |
---|---|---|
Wagers | Virtual currency only | Real money |
Potential to Win Cash | No (virtual prizes only) | Yes (real monetary payouts) |
Legal Status | Generally unregulated | Licensed and regulated |
Social Experience | Strong social features, community play | Mainly solo play (except poker, bingo) |
Cost | Free to play, with optional in-app purchases | Requires deposits for real wagers |
